A 75kg astronaut is holding a 5kg ball while in deepspace. He wants to use the ball to travel backwards towards his ship by throwing the ball foward. He estimates that he can throw the ball with velocity 20m/s. What velocity will he acquire? and how long will it take him if his ship is 20m away?
